I've installed a new license on a Linux server I'm running on a cloud service over VMWare.
This server will have just 2 domain, so the "Web Admin Edition" should work.
My question is, do I have to buy VPS or dedicated license? Don't understand if the licence is for running VPS inside Plesk or for plesk running on a VPS.
Thank you!
 
If you're going to be running in a virtual machine (like you are), I would go with a VPS license. If you were running on bare metal, I would go with dedicate. The price difference doesn't matter until you reach the Web Host Edition version anyways where it makes a big difference with how deployments are done.
